Understanding Door Lock Types
Before picking a replacement lock, it's vital to understand the different kinds of door locks and their respective functionalities. Here are the most common types:
Deadbolt Locks: These locks offer superior security compared to spring bolt locks. They require an essential or a thumb turn to operate and are available in single and double-cylinder variations.
Spring Bolt Locks: These are the typical keyed locks; they immediately lock when the door closes. Nevertheless, they can be susceptible to forced entry.
Smart Locks: These modern locks run via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, or a keypad. They permit keyless entry and are perfect for tech-savvy people.
Padlocks: Versatile and portable, padlocks are often used for securing gates, sheds, or as additional security measures on doors.
Mortise Locks: Common in commercial settings, these locks suit a pocket within the door and offer robust security, frequently used in combination with deadbolts.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Lock
When selecting the ideal lock for your doors, numerous aspects need to be thought about:
Security Level: Understand the security requirements of your home. For higher-risk locations, go with deadbolts or smart locks with innovative functions.
Sturdiness: Look for weather-resistant materials, especially for exterior doors. Stainless steel or brass locks stand up to the aspects better than others.
Ease of Use: Consider how lots of people will use the lock and their comfort level with key, keypad, or smart lock gain access to.
Visual Appeal: Choose locks that complement your door and the overall design of your home.
Installation Requirements: Some locks need professional installation, while others are DIY-friendly.
Cost Point: Quality locks can vary from affordable to high-end luxury designs. Choose a budget fitting your security needs.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the best type of lock for home security?
The very best type of lock for home security typically varies based on private needs. However, high-quality deadbolts or smart locks are generally suggested for their remarkable resistance to unapproved entry.
How do I know which size lock fits my door?
Many locks feature sizing info. Measure the density of your door and check the backset (the range from the edge of the door to the center of the lock) to ensure compatibility.
Can I set up a lock myself?
Lots of locks are developed for DIY installation, total with detailed instructions. However, for high-security locks or complicated setups, it may be a good idea to employ an expert locksmith.
What's the distinction between a single and double-cylinder deadbolt?
A single-cylinder deadbolt uses a secret on the outdoors and a thumb turn on the within, while a double-cylinder requires a secret for both sides, providing included security but potentially posturing a safety risk throughout emergency situations.
How typically should I change my door locks?
It's a good idea to alter your locks if you move into a new residential or commercial property, after a break-in, or approximately every 5-7 years depending upon wear and tear.
